Do you simply want a computer for basic, everyday features like responding to emails and browsing the Web? Then you could also be nice with a fundamental mannequin that has restricted memory and a median central processing unit (or CPU -- the pc's "brain"). You may as well get away with integrated graphics (constructed into the pc). Will you be downloading and modifying a variety of images, music and videos? In that case, you may want additional memory to retailer your expanding media collection. You will also want a fast CPU (quad-core or six-core), and loads of memory (RAM), as well as a graphics card. Next, speak about prices. How a lot money do you wish to spend? Do you've gotten the area for a full-sized desktop pc? If you are cramming the pc into the corner of an already packed desk, consider getting something smaller -- like a compact Laptop or laptop computer. If you're on a restricted funds, wish to surf the net and test e-mail, but not much else and you undoubtedly do not wish to lay our a fortune, get a compact Laptop. They price about $300 to $600, plus they take up about half the space of a daily desktop. The disadvantage is that they do not offer much processing energy, however try to be in a position to add memory.
Or, look into buying a tower pc with a lower-finish processor or older hardware. You can spend as little as $500, but still get good speed out of your processor. The disadvantage is that you might have hassle taking part in again excessive-resolution graphics and movies, and older PCs are more durable to upgrade. If in case you have a little money to spend, but do not want all the bells and whistles, purchase a desktop computer with a dual-core CPU and four to eight gigabytes (GB) of Memory Wave Protocol. You may also get decent media playback, plus a Blu-ray drive (in most computers). If you are serious about pictures, Memory Wave movies or video games, go for a efficiency Laptop with a quad-core or six-core CPU and eight GB or more of memory. Although it's going to set you again $1,500 or extra, you'll get a processor that may handle essentially the most detailed graphics. Critical players can add a large hard drive and a graphics card.
For a lower-value resolution, simply buy extra RAM and a graphics card. If you're not pc-savvy, get an all-in-one desktop Pc, which contains the monitor and CPU in a single unit. Plug it in and you are just about able to go. A Laptop with a touchscreen makes computing even simpler. Busy professionals should go for a laptop computer. They've got enough memory to make use of at house, plus they're portable enough to take with you. You can improve the laptop's processing unit if you want to make use of it to play excessive-end games, or get one outfitted with a Blu-ray drive so you possibly can watch excessive-def films.
